Ethical consumerism (alternatively called ethical consumption, ethical purchasing, moral purchasing, ethical sourcing, ethical shopping or green consumerism) is a type of consumer activism that is based on the concept of dollar voting. The Immigrant Worker Center IWC is a social justice organization based in Montreal, Québec, Canada.
